1 Come, humble sinner, in whose breast,
A thousand tho’ts revolve,
Come, with your guilt and fear oppressed,
And make this last resolve;
Come, with your guilt and fear oppressed,
And make this last resolve.
2 I’ll go to Jesus, though my sin
Hath like a mountain rose;
I know His courts, I’ll enter in,
Whatever may oppose;
I know His courts, I’ll enter in,
Whatever may oppose.
3 Perhaps He may admit my plea,
Perhaps will hear my prayer;
But, if I perish, I will pray,
And perish only there;
But, if I perish, I will pray,
And perish only there.
4 I can but perish if I go;
I am resolved to try;
But if I stay away, I know
I must forever die;
But if I stay away, I know
I must forever die.
